To find the best realtor for your needs, look for a specialist in the area you're searching for homes. Make sure to ask how many homes they have helped clients buy or sell in the area in the past year. A specialist will have a wide range of knowledge about the available listings and can provide you with advice on homes, schools, shopping, and other community related things.
Don't rush into a purchase. Take at least 24 hours before making an offer on a home to ensure that you're making the right decision. If you're buying a home on an island, make sure to research flooding issues. Some areas on islands are extremely flood prone and can flood whenever it rains. This is important information if you plan to live there year-round.
If you find a motivated seller, you may be able to get them to work with you to pay the closing costs. This process is called seller concessions or contributions and can save you upwards of nine percent of the cost of the home.
When looking at potential homes, don't focus too much on the decor. Things like paint colors can be changed after you buy the property, so don't let that stop you from making a purchase. It's also a good idea to hire a professional home inspector to conduct a standard inspection on the home before you finalize your offer. This can help you avoid costly home buying mistakes.
